
Materion's Advanced Materials Selected for New U.S. Army Tiltrotor Aircraft Prototypes
CLEVELAND--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Materion Corporation (NYSE: MTRN), a global leader in advanced materials solutions, will supply its SupremEX ® metal matrix composite for components on the U.S. Army Future Long-Range Assault Aircraft (FLRAA) prototypes. The high-strength, lightweight composite was selected by Bell Textron Inc., a Textron Inc. company, which designed the FLRAA configuration and will build the prototypes. The new tiltrotor model can reach greater speeds and carry increased payloads of troops and equipment, reaching battlefields faster and at farther ranges.
'We look forward to working with Bell to equip the U.S. Army with a new aircraft design that provides greater reach and capability,' stated Clive Grannum, President Performance Materials at Materion. 'FLRAA will play a vital role in U.S. Army operations, and SupremEX composites will help enable greater capabilities in operation. These composites significantly reduce weight while maintaining their high-strength properties for long-term reliability.'
'We are pleased to welcome Materion to the FLRAA team,' stated Ryan Ehinger, senior vice president and program director for FLRAA at Bell. 'FLRAA will change the way U.S. Army aviators fight by providing significant increases in speed, range, and reliability. We have a shared commitment to delivering this transformational capability to our warfighters.'
With a product portfolio that includes high-strength specialty alloys; lightweight, stiff metal matrix composites; and thin film coatings, Materion's advanced materials address a wide range of technical demands in defense and aerospace applications. As new applications and technologies such as FLRAA are developed, Materion is uniquely positioned to meet emerging materials needs.

Noah's Q1 2025 Earnings Show YoY and Sequential Growth in Profitability and Operating Margin Expansion
SHANGHAI, May 30, 2025 /PRNewswire/ -- Noah Holdings Limited ("Noah" or the "Company") (NYSE: NOAH and HKEX: 6686), a leading and pioneer wealth management service provider offering comprehensive one-stop advisory services on global investment and asset allocation primarily for global Chinese high-net-worth investors ("HNWIs"), reported unaudited financial results for the first quarter of 2025, highlighting a robust recovery in profitability as its CAPEX-light domestic restructuring and overseas expansion gain momentum. Non-GAAP net income rebounded 27.4% sequentially to RMB 168.8 million (US$23.3 million), while income from operations jumped 35.2% to RMB 186.0 million (US$25.6 million), driving operating margin to 30.3%. Noah continued to face broader headwinds driven by a volatile global macroeconomic environment and a low-interest rate environment in mainland China, impacting Chinese HNWI sentiment and topline growth. Despite these challenges, Noah continued to make significant progress in building out its sales teams and global infrastructure. Its CAPEX-light strategy ensures its business remains profitable and continues to generate solid cash flow during this restructuring. Zander Yin, Co-Founder, Director, and CEO of Noah, commented, "We are proud to deliver a strong rebound in profitability and operating margin this quarter, reflecting the success of our operational efficiency initiatives, CAPEX-light strategy, and accelerating overseas expansion. This clearly underscores the resilience of our business model during our ongoing restructuring and sets the stage for sustainable growth going forward. This restructuring still requires upfront investments and will take time to scale. While we are not yet at the finish line, these cost-effective foundational changes are clearly beginning to have an impact on our financials which leave us confident we are headed in the right direction." Financial Highlights Total net revenues for the quarter were RMB 614.6 million (US$84.7 million), down 5.7% from last quarter and down 5.4% year-over-year, primarily due to a decrease in distribution of insurance products and RMB-denominated private equity recurring service fees. However, net revenues from overseas continued to grow sequentially, expanding 5.0% to RMB 304.2 million (US$41.9 million) and now accounting for nearly 50% of total net revenues – showcasing the progress it continues to make in expanding overseas. Rigorous cost controls reduced operating costs and expenses by 16.7% sequentially and 18.8% year-over-year to RMB428.6 million (US$59.1 million), led by a 21.8% year-over-year cut in compensation and benefits and an 18.1% decline in selling expenses. Overseas Expansion Making Progress Noah's overseas expansion continued to gain momentum. Revenue from overseas investment products grew 20.3% year-over-year, offsetting a 22.8% decline in overseas insurance sales. USD-denominated assets under management climbed 14.2% year-over-year to US$5.9 billion, and USD-denominated assets under advisory rose 8.7% to US$9.1 billion. Noah's team of overseas relationship managers is driving this growth. The team expanded 44% year-over-year to 131, with its newly formed overseas commission-only insurance agent team also growing to 75 and already contributing approximately RMB 10 million in revenue during the quarter. The Company opened a new office in Japan and continues to explore opportunities in the US, Southeast Asia and Canada with large and underserved communities of Chinese HNWIs. Domestic Restructuring Domestic net revenues in the quarter were RMB 310.4 million, down 14.3% from last quarter and 9.4% from the same period last year, reflecting weaker insurance distribution under a low-interest environment and lower recurring service fees from private equity products. However, transaction value for RMB-denominated private secondary products surged 257.7% year-over-year to RMB 3.3 billion, up 34.6% sequentially, with associated revenue contribution rising 9.4% year-over-year. Noah's branch network has been consolidated to 10 cities in mainland China and has begun deploying online marketing and online services which will further reduce fixed costs and improve operational efficiency going forward. Driving Shareholder Returns Noah continues to prioritize shareholder interests and deliver sustained returns through its US$50 million share buyback program with the repurchase of more than 1.3 million ADSs to date. Subject to approval at its upcoming annual general meeting in June 2025, the Company plans to distribute RMB 550 million in annual and special dividends in July 2025—equal to 100% of 2024's non-GAAP net income attributable to Noah shareholders—delivering a 11% dividend yield at current prices and marking the second consecutive year of a full payout. As of March 31, 2025, cash and cash equivalents stood at RMB 4.1 billion, supplemented by RMB 1.3 billion in highly liquid short-term investments. The balance sheet remains robust, with US$11.4 per ADS in cash reserves, an improved current ratio of 4.8x, no interest-bearing debt, a price-to-book multiple of 0.5x and a price-to-earnings multiple of 11x, well below the industry average.
